Installing the MAF-T 2.01
 
It looks like it is just plug and play but there are 2 loose wires. A white wire and a blue wire with the tips pre-spliced. What do I do with these 2?

scheides 03-02-2005 09:07 AM

Re: Installing the MAF-T 2.01
 
wite wire goes to rpm signal (wite wire coming off CAS is a good lead), the blue wire is the aux lead, if you want to make adjustments for when you're running h2o or n2o injection.

Will there be a blue wire off the CAS that I can splice in to..or what should I be looking for?

scheides 03-02-2005 01:36 PM

Re: Installing the MAF-T 2.01
 
White wire off the CAS...solder that to the white wire on the maf-t. leave the blue wire alone, tape it off.
